The Defense Logistics Agency awarded TREADWELL CORPORATION of Thomaston, Connecticut, a firm-fixed-price contract valued at $241,132.68 for the procurement of one unit of a BLADDER, OXYGEN GENE identified by NSN 3655006846696 and part number PR 7011660201. The contract, issued under solicitation SPE4A7-25-Q-1535 and modified via SPE4A726P3903, was awarded on July 17, 2026, with an effective modification date of December 11, 2025. Performance is to occur at the contractor’s facility in Thomaston, CT, and the NAICS code 339113 applies to the manufacturing of medical and dental instruments. The only explicitly included contractual clause is FAR 52.222-90, “Addressing DEI Discrimination by Federal Contractors,” implemented under DoD Class Deviation 2026-00040, Revision 1, which prohibits racially discriminatory DEI practices and mandates strict compliance, subcontractor reporting, record access, and material compliance under 31 U.S.C. 3729(b)(4). No other clauses, packaging, preservation, or marking requirements are specified, nor are there details on inspection locations, acceptance criteria, quality standards, or technical specifications beyond the NSN. The contract type is not formally designated, and no option periods, delivery schedules, FOB terms, or payment instructions are provided. The contracting officer is Dean Allen, with Carl Allen as the point of contact, but no COR or COTR is named. The awardee’s CAGE code is 81412, and while a Unique Entity ID is not listed, the contractor is subject to federal compliance obligations under the DEI clause, including potential debarment for noncompliance. No socioeconomic status, size certification, or additional attachments are disclosed.

Hospital Specialty beds
Solicitation # W81K0026RA050
This solicitation, identified as W81K0026RA050, seeks specialty hospital beds under an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ract with a performance period from October 1, 2026, to September 30, 2031. The requirement is for the lease of specialized therapeutic and mobility beds, including intensive care beds, smart connected medical surgical beds, early mobility verticalization beds, motorized bariatric chairs, and an automated axial proning system bed, to support patient care at Brooke Army Medical Center and the Institute for Surgical Research in San Antonio, Texas. The solicitation clarifies that delivery is limited to these two locations only, and the estimated quantity of 60 per CLIN refers to jobs or rental events, not units or annual volumes, reflecting the IDIQ nature where usage is unpredictable and pricing is submitted on a per-unit basis. Vendors must respond with a firm fixed price for each item using a provided pricing spreadsheet and are required to deliver any requested bed to the designated military facility within four hours of notification, seven days a week, including holidays. Proposals must meet stringent technical standards, including full adjustability (Fowler, Trendelenburg, cardiac chair positions), pressure relief capability, patient weight capacity up to 1,000 pounds, integrated patient weighing features, battery backup, and climate-controlled mattress materials that prevent infection and maintain skin dryness. Technical submissions must demonstrate compliance through a detailed plan addressing general bed features, rapid delivery procedures, and recovery logistics for returned equipment. Evaluation will follow a lowest price technically acceptable (LPTA) process; proposals must receive an Acceptable rating across all technical subfactors to be eligible, with award going to the lowest-priced responsive offer. Participation requires SAM registration, submission of a completed SF 1449 with CAGE and UEI codes, and adherence to cybersecurity and compliance clauses including safeguarding defense information, prohibiting certain telecommunications equipment, combating human trafficking, and restrictions on business with sanctioned regimes. Invoicing must be done electronically via WAWF, and vendors are responsible for on-site training at no cost to the government, immediate reporting of defects or recalls, and compliance with all deviation-modified FAR and DFARS clauses. Submission is due by August 13, 2026, at 11:00 a.m. CST to the Medical Readiness Control Office West in San Antonio.
